Sec. 105. CONTINUING THE ROLE OF THE DEPARTMENT OF VETERANS AFFAIRS

## SEC. 105 CONTINUING THE ROLE OF THE DEPARTMENT OF VETERANS AFFAIRS Section 8117(g) of title 38, United States Code, is amended by striking “such sums as may be necessary to carry out this section for each of fiscal years 2007 through 2011” and inserting “$155,300,000 for each of fiscal years 2014 through 2018 to carry out this section”. # TITLE II OPTIMIZING STATE AND LOCAL ALL-HAZARDS PREPAREDNESS AND RESPONSE
